“Today I Am a Man”

In "Today I Am a Man," Harvey Pekar delivers another quietly powerful slice of life, following Joy as she navigates the awkward terrain of job hunting with dry wit and quiet resignation. The story unfolds with a simple yet telling moment—one phone call that lingers longer than expected—captured in the stark, expressive lines of Chandler Wood’s art, with Dean Haspiel’s cover adding a touch of wry, observational charm.

Joy is unimpressed with the phone manner of a doctor to whom she applies for a job, so doesn't bother following-up. When she does a while later she's surprised.
